About the Role

We are looking for a Principal HR Business Partner to join our People team. In this role, you will be a strategic advisor to our Engineering and Product (EPD) leadership teams, taking on high-impact people challenges and initiatives that directly influence our ability to scale. You will provide expert coaching on performance management, strategic hiring, and career development, ensuring our technical teams have the environment they need to thrive.

At Rula, we want to be a place where everyone can do their career's best work. You will leverage in-depth functional knowledge to lead significant projects, such as ensuring Rula has the talent density required to achieve our 2026 goals. We are looking for a practitioner who can think ahead and offer strategic insights while remaining willing to roll up their sleeves to get things done. As a champion of our "Handle with Care" value, you will navigate complex technical org dynamics with empathy and fairness, utilizing your proven knack for building trust with executive stakeholders.

Required Qualifications
• 7+ years of HRBP experience, with at least 3+ years in a dedicated role supporting Engineering or Product organizations.
• Proven track record acting as a strategic advisor to executive leadership, capable of leading significant projects with minimal day-to-day supervision.
• Demonstrated ability to interpret complex people metrics and dashboards to identify trends in engagement and turnover, turning insights into actionable recommendations.
• Strong ability to build trust-based relationships with technical stakeholders and use coaching frameworks to help leaders solve problems independently.
• Ability to analyze root causes and evaluate risks/benefits to drive impactful outcomes that align with broader company objectives.

Preferred Qualifications
• Experience navigating both high-growth start-up environments and mature, large-scale organizations.
• Google Suite, specifically advanced Sheets and Pivot tables.
• Proficiency in using RAPID and RACI frameworks to clarify roles, responsibilities, and decision-making processes.
